Policies and Frequently Asked Questions 


Q: Why do most of your students return each month? Will they learn the same thing?
A: Over seventy percent of our students attend more than one month. Students in the Winter Training and Hitting Camps continue to learn new skills each month while building on skills taught previously. We separate the veterans from the ³rookies² starting their first month.

Q: Can parents stay during their child¹s class?
A: We encourage you to stay and watch your child. We also have a lounge area for parents who want to catch up on work, watch sports on a projection TV or read the paper.

Q: My child is a great baseball player. Why should he go to school for baseball?
A:Even if your child is great now, later competition will expose bad habits that will be harder to correct. Learn the right way from the pros, the first time.

Q: My child loves baseball but is not very good at it. Can he/she attend?
A: Yes, our instructors take an individual approach to each and every player. Students learn at their own pace. They will have improved their confidence before the beginning of the season.

Q: Does your school sell out?
A: Yes. Ask anyone who has come before. Sign up early.

Q: Do I have to pay the full amount if I am going for more than one month or more than one clinic?
A: No, you only place a $50 deposit on each class you sign up for. We then bill in installments.

Q: Do I get back my deposit if I cancel out of a session?
A: Yes, you will get your deposit back if you cancel seven days before the session starts. Please understand our classes sell out. By canceling last minute you have taken a spot from another student.

Q: What happens if my child gets sick during their scheduled class time.
A: We will do our best to make up the class to your child. We will select a class that will not effect our balance of student to teacher ratio during the winter schedule.
